    You download it immediately after your credit/debit card info is verified. No e-mail downloads. It is a pretty fast download with a high speed connection. Dial up may take some time if that's your method. Once you save the game just burn a backup copy and you'll be protected against losing your copy. Clay also pointed out that if you save the download connection in your favorites menu you can go back any time for your copy.

    If he already paid for the download he doesn't need to go to Best Buy and pay for it again.

    The download is one file that is about 100 MB. It's an .exe file that installs the game when you double-click on it. So, to back up the file you could just copy that file to a CD-R. If you lose your hard drive or buy a new computer, copy the file to your new hard drive and then double-click to install Baseball Mogul.
